2010 TWD to GHS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2010

During 2010, the TWD to GHS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 30, valuing the pair at 0.0511.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on June 7, dropping to 0.0438.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0073 GHS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0447 to the December average rate of 0.0490, the exchange rate registered a net change of 9.49%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0451 0.0445 0.0447
February 0.0448 0.0444 0.0446
March 0.0448 0.0443 0.0446
April 0.0453 0.0447 0.0450
May 0.0452 0.0441 0.0446
June 0.0451 0.0438 0.0444
July 0.0454 0.0445 0.0450
August 0.0454 0.0448 0.0450
September 0.0459 0.0448 0.0452
October 0.0469 0.0457 0.0464
November 0.0478 0.0470 0.0475
December 0.0511 0.0476 0.0490
